Greek court
Greek court acquits activists over 2021 protest against Beijing Olympics
World
November 20, 2022
Greek court acquits activists over 2021 protest against Beijing Olympics
A Greek court has acquitted three activists detained in October 2021 after unfurling banners at the Athens Acropolis opposing the…